Vacant Land Deal - Error in County Records?

Jason Polley
  • Investor
  • Gilbert, AZ
Posted

Hi BP experts,

Long time lurker, first time poster.

I have a gentlemen that responded to my direct mail campaign and we came to a verbal agreement for me to buy 4 pieces of vacant land from him.  However, I am finding in the tax records that he only owns 3 parcels.  He inherited them back in the '80s and is having trouble finding the paperwork.  Of course, I'll need all of the info so I can fill out the purchase agreement properly.

Who is my best bet to sort this out?  Call the county?  If so, which department?  He is confident he owns 4 parcels.

Thanks for the guidance.
